Transaction 331c9325916c801783bc2e351456c131e5dfaa8b6bdb5a23dd95b3d6319c01aa
1 Input
1 Output
-
331c9325916c801783bc2e351456c131e5dfaa8b6bdb5a23dd95b3d6319c01aa:0
- value
- 1566205
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1510d35017cbca492b703cd19c9b32ee7fdbfe3 OP_EQUAL
- address
- 3KKBS8WM3BU91vNPqCrskBDXyQt8x1fhAM